AR# 13649

5.1i XST - "ERROR:HDLParsers: 3264 - Can't read file file_name.vhd: No such file or directory..."


Keywords: UniSim, UniSims, Project Navigator, component

Urgency: Standard

General Description:
After I synthesize with XST, the following error occurs:

"ERROR:HDLParsers:3264 - Can't read file D:/Tools/Xilinx/m4.1i/vhdl/src/unisims/unisim_VCOMP.vhd: No such file or directory
CPU : 0.36 / 0.48 s | Elapsed : 0.00 / 0.00 s"



This warning occurs because the UniSims library has been created from within Project Navigator, and the UniSim files have been added. Since this occurs automatically, you do not need to perform this process.

Deleting the library does not prevent the error; you must delete the implementation data.


An XST input file that contains a listing of all of the source files causes XST to report the above error if a space precedes the library name and file.

For example:

The space on the first line must be removed as follows:

If Project Navigator is consistently creating a .prj file that causes XST to fail (Project Navigator creates a .prj file every time the XST synthesis process is run), then you must make the file "read only", as follows:

1. Right-click on file.
2. Select "Properties".
3. Select the "Read Only" attribute on the General tab.
Date 10/20/2005
Status Archive
Type General Article